RULE

September 30, 2015 by Cosette

cover image of Wonderful Words

“The Lord hath prepared his throne in the heavens; and his kingdom ruleth over all” (Psalm 103:19). Wisdom says, “By me princes rule, and nobles, even all the judges of the earth” (Proverbs 8:16). “He that ruleth his spirit [is better] than he that taketh a city” (Proverbs 16:32). “And thou Bethlehem, in the land of Juda, art not the least among the princes of Juda: for out of thee shall come a Governor, that shall rule my people Israel” (Matthew 2:6). “And let the peace of God rule in your hearts, to the which also ye are called in one body; and be ye thankful” (Colossians 3:15). “Let the elders that rule well be counted worthy of double honour, especially they who labour in the word and doctrine” (1 Timothy 5:17).

Golden thought: Let the peace of God rule in your hearts.

[Excerpt adapted from Wonderful Words by Stewart Custer (September 30 reading).]
